Will the IRS notify the taxpayer if the RMD penalty is waved after filing Form 5329 asking for asking for the waiver?
Yes, on page 8 of the 5329 instructions it says: "The IRS will review the information you provide and decide whether to grant your request for a waiver."
If denied, it will give you the penalty and send you a letter explaining the denial. IRS does not do these very fast.
https://www.irs.gov/pub/irs-pdf/i5329.pdf
see page 8 of 9.

Will the IRS notify the taxpayer if the RMD penalty is waved after filing Form 5329 asking for asking for the waiver?
In many cases there is no notification of granting the waiver, so no news is good news. If the IRS denies the waiver, which would be unusual, they'll bill for the penalty.
